資料結構 順序表合併操作

2021-08-01 16:01:43 字數 853 閱讀 7710

uoion_sort_2.c 函式

#include "c1.h"

#include "c2_1.h"

#include

#include

/*線性表la和lb中的元素按值非遞減排列,歸併la和lb得到新的線性表lc,lc的數值也按非遞減排列*/

void mergelist2(sqlist la,sqlist lb,sqlist *lc)

while(pa<=pa_last)//表la非空且表lb空

*pc++=*pa++;//插入la的剩餘元素

while(pb<=pb_last)

*pc++=*pb++;

}

main.c函式

#include "c1.h"

#include "c2_1.h"

#include

#include

/*線性表la和lb中的元素按值非遞減排列,歸併la和lb得到新的線性表lc,lc的數值也按非遞減排列*/

void mergelist2(sqlist la,sqlist lb,sqlist *lc)

while(pa<=pa_last)//表la非空且表lb空

*pc++=*pa++;//插入la的剩餘元素

資料結構 順序表操作

define max size 1000 include include typedef int datatype typedef struct seqlist seqlist void seqprint seqlist psl 列印順序表 void seqlistinit seqlist psl ...

基礎資料結構 線性表 順序表的合併操作

順序表的合併操作 題目描述 建立順序表的類,屬性包括 陣列 實際長度 最大長度 設定為1000 已知兩個遞增序列,把兩個序列的資料合併到順序表中,並使得順序表的資料遞增有序 輸入第1行先輸入n表示有n個資料,接著輸入n個資料,表示第1個序列,要求資料遞增互不等 第2行先輸入m表示有m個資料,接著輸入...

資料結構 順序表的操作

1 輸入一組整型元素序列,建立順序表。2 實現該順序表的遍歷。3 在該順序表中進行順序查詢某一元素,查詢成功返回1,否則返回0。4 判斷該順序表中元素是否對稱,對稱返回1,否則返回0。5 實現把該表中所有奇數排在偶數之前,即表的前面為奇數,後面為偶數。6 輸入整型元素序列利用有序表插入演算法建立乙個...